Abstract

The presence of large amount of data and need for turning such a huge data into knowledge has made data mining an important field of research. The huge amounts of data growing at a fast rate, makes it impossible for humans to analyse and extract knowledge from such data.For solving real-world optimization problems, optimization tools are required. Many Nature Inspired Algorithms namely Swarm Optimization, Firefly Algorithm, and Cuckoo search etc. have been used for mining. This paper presents a survey of some nature inspired algorithm which have been used for mining.
